Custom MMIC Distributed Amplifier CMD197

Description
The CMD197 is a wideband GaAs MMIC distributed driver amplifier ideally suited for military, space, and communications systems where small size and high linearity are critical design requirements. At 10 GHz the device delivers greater than 16 dB of gain with a corresponding output 1 dB compression point of +22 dBm and an output IP3 of 32 dBm. The CMD197 LNA is a 50 ohm matched design which eliminates the need for RF port matching and includes an on chip bias choke. The CMD197 also offers full passivation for increased reliability and moisture protection.
